    Misalignment

    Over time, bifold doors may be damaged and misaligned due to wear and tear. The doors may not be closing correctly, the track could be sagging, or the hinges may be loosening and require tightening.

    This is a common problem with bifold doors. First, you should determine whether the tracks require to be cleaned and whether any debris must be removed. It may be necessary to reset the door guide inside the head track. Close the door to the closet and make sure the edge of the doors is parallel to the frame. After you have adjusted the track, open and close the doors to ensure that they work smoothly and securely closed.

    The pivot hinges may not be aligned. Doors will usually stick when trying to open or close them. This can be a risky issue since it means that people have to fight with the door to open and close it, possibly injuring themselves. To fix this issue, loosen the screws on the top left and right hinge brackets. Then, shift the pivot to a place where the door can close easily.

    Hardware Issues

    If they're external or internal, bifold doors can often become stuck when trying to open or close them. This can lead to them becoming damaged or worn out, and requiring replacement. This is likely caused by an absence of regular maintenance or cleaning. To prevent this from happening, make sure that you clean and lubricate your tracks. This will help prevent them from becoming blocked or stuck.

    If you have a set of doors that are constantly sticking when they close and open, you should make sure there isn't an obstruction blocking their track. Check that the hinges and the track are properly secured and there are no gaps or debris around the frame.

    uPVC bifolding doors can become difficult to open after a while as with any other door. This could be due a range of issues such as dirt in the track or the door being too tight. It's also possible that the locking mechanism is failed. Regular maintenance can avoid the majority of these issues.

    One of the most common bifold door problems is the repairing bottom of bifold door rollers or hinges breaking. This is because these components are used frequently and are subjected to many pressures. If they're not looked after properly, they can break or even fall off of the track.

    Luckily, this is easily repaired with an adjustable wrench or a pair of pliers to twist the nut that surrounds the pin. You can also remove both the door and the bracket to make a shim that can raise or lower the door. This is a cheap and simple solution to fix this problem, and it should only take a few minutes. In more severe cases you'll have to replace the part entirely. However, this isn't usually required if the issue is intermittently occurring.     doorpanels-300x200.jpgCracked Corners

    Unlike sliding closet doors, which rest on tracks, bifold door panels are supported by pins in brackets screwed into the floor and side or top jamb. These brackets are adjustable to allow the door panel to move one way or another. If the brackets are damaged or loose, they may cause the corner to crack or bend. This could result in doors not closing properly or even opening completely.

    The problem is usually easy to fix and diagnose. You'll first need to determine the source of the noise. If the noise is coming from the track, it could be that something has become stuck or stuck and needs to be cleaned. If the rattling is caused by the mechanism or hinges, it can usually be fixed by loosening the screws and moving the door back into place. Then, tighten the screw and lubricate to prevent further problems.

    If your bifold doors are aluminium or constructed from composite materials, it's important to use the right cleaning solutions and techniques. Begin by wiping the frame clean with a gentle, all-purpose cleaning product and a soft rag. Make sure you remove any dirt and dust traces. Avoid scrubbing or scouring with any abrasive material to ensure that the bifold doors isn't damaged in the process. Afterward, wash your door frames with water and dry them thoroughly. This will ensure that your bifold doors appear great and last longer. Keep your hinges lubricated as well to reduce the risk of damage caused by excessive friction or stress.     Loose Hinges

    One of the most frequent complaints about bifold doors is that they can be difficult to open or close. This could be hazardous and will not just hinder the flow of your home. Many people get caught getting themselves in a pinch as they struggle to get the door moving. Simple maintenance and repairs can help to avoid this.

    If your door is stuck, try loosening the set screw in the top bracket by turning it counterclockwise. This will give the door a slight pull and make it easier to open or close. Then tighten the set screw once more. Repeat this process until you can move the door without difficulty.

    If the pivot pin or anchor has been sunk into the wood, or is wobbly, it could also cause the bifold door to sag. This can be fixed by taking the door out, putting it on a surface and loosening the top set screw located in the upper right and left corner. This will pull the pivot pins or anchors out and allow you to tighten the screws.

    Over time, the corners where the top and bottom anchor or pivot pins are situated can begin to crack. This can also be caused by fluctuations in temperature or other factors that impact the wood. This is a quick and inexpensive fix for your Bifold.

    Apply only a small amount (less than 1 teaspoon) of epoxy on the cracked area. Wait for the epoxy to completely dry before using your bifold door for the second time.

    Other easy solutions include applying grease to the track and lubricating hinges. You can also use a rubber mallet to press the pivot or anchor pins into place if they're wobbly or not in alignment with the frame. Lastly, you can add washers to the screw that holds the handle in the event that it is loose. This will prevent the screw from pushing through the hole in the door and looking like a Kludge.
